Saint John New Brunswick News Today Headlines

For residents and those interested in Atlantic Canada, Saint John New Brunswick news serves as a vital pulse on the region's daily rhythm. This port city, the oldest incorporated city in Canada, offers a unique blend of maritime heritage, modern industry, and cultural revival. Staying informed about the latest developments here means understanding the economic shifts, community stories, and environmental factors that shape this dynamic area.

Economic Currents and Port Activity

The economy of Saint John is intrinsically linked to its position as a major shipping hub, and local news frequently reflects the ebb and flow of this sector. Updates on the Port of Saint John's operations, cargo volumes, and infrastructure projects are staples of regional reporting. These stories often detail how global trade trends impact local employment and business growth, from the bustling activity at the Long Wharf to the modernization of terminal facilities that ensure the city remains a competitive gateway for Atlantic Canada.

Focus on the Saint John River

The Saint John River itself is both a lifeline and a central character in the city’s narrative. Reporting often focuses on water quality monitoring, flood management strategies, and environmental conservation efforts along its banks. These stories are critical as the river dictates much of the city's geography and recreational life. Keeping an eye on initiatives to preserve this natural resource is key to understanding the long-term sustainability of the region.
